1. A method for charging an electrochemical device through a cyclical charging and discharging process, comprising:
in a first cycle stage of the cyclical charging and discharging process, a charging stage of the first cycle stage having a first cut-off current; and
in a second cycle stage of the cyclical charging and discharging process, a charging stage of the second cycle stage having a second cut-off current, wherein the second cut-off current is greater than the first cut-off current, wherein the cyclical charging and discharging process comprises n charging and discharging cycle stages in sequence, the n cycle stages are respectively defined as ith cycle stages, i=1, 2, . . . , n, n is a positive integer greater than 1, a previous cycle stage of the ith cycle stage is defined as a (i−1)th cycle stage, the charging stage of the ith cycle stage has an ith cut-off current, the charging stage of the (i−1)th cycle stage has a (i−1)th cut-off current, and the ith cut-off current is greater than the (i−1)th cut-off current,
wherein the ith cycle stage further comprises (i) a constant-current charging stage during which the electrochemical device is charged to an ith cut-off voltage by an ith current associated with the constant-current charging stage, (ii) a constant-voltage charging stage during which the electrochemical device is charged to the ith cut-off current by an ith voltage associated with the constant-voltage charging stage, and (iii) a discharging stage during which the electrochemical device is discharged to a preset discharging cut-off voltage by a preset discharging current associated with the discharging stage.
